Mark
Farina
Origin: Chicago,
IL
Years Playing: 21 years
Style: SF and Chicago deep dubby underground
house and Mushroom Jazz

The
track/DJ/party that made me want to be a DJ was:
Hearing Hot Mix 5 on the radio
circa
1985.
Influences:
The Police, Rush, Yellow, and playing
trumpet in
concert/marching band.
I
got my first break:
Meeting resident DJ Terry Martin outside of
Medusa
(Chicago club) and being invited to hang out in the DJ booth the
following
week.

If
I could put together MY dream music festival, the Entertainment
would
be:
A 3-night festival with three bands and one
DJ playing
in between the bands' sets each night. Night 1: The Police,
Talking
Heads, and Rush with myself as DJ. Night 2: James Brown, Tribe
Called
Quest reunion, and Cymande, with DJ Spinna as DJ. Night 3:
Kraftwerk,
Yellow, and Liasons Dangereuse, with Derrick Carter as DJ.
